The 2 Checks That Establish Your son or daughter's Long term
When it comes to private college admissions, there are just two IQ assessments that make any difference:
The WPPSI-IV (Wechsler Preschool and first Scale of Intelligence – Fourth Version) for ages 4 yrs to seven yrs, 7 months.
The WISC-V (Wechsler Intelligence Scale for Children – Fifth Version) for ages six yrs to 16 yrs, 11 months.

Here is what most mother and father don't have an understanding of: These exams Really don't just evaluate intelligence. They offer an extensive cognitive profile that reveals your son or daughter's special strengths and Discovering type.
The WPPSI-IV actions five essential spots that expose your son or daughter's cognitive strengths: verbal comprehension demonstrates how nicely they recognize and use language, visual spatial capabilities demonstrate their expertise for examining visual info and solving spatial issues, fluid reasoning reveals their sensible wondering skills, Operating memory implies their ability to carry and manipulate facts mentally, and processing speed steps how speedily they might entire mental jobs properly.
The WISC-V covers very similar floor but with age-acceptable complexity, inspecting verbal comprehension for language expertise and verbal reasoning, visual spatial processing and visual-motor coordination, fluid reasoning for abstract wondering and difficulty-fixing, working memory for awareness and concentration, and processing speed for mental efficiency.
